This episode focused on Amy's journey with Apex Toastmasters, which she joined two years ago seeking social interaction after transitioning to remote work during the pandemic. Key discussion points included:

  • Amy's growth in public speaking confidence through Toastmasters, progressing from an introverted financial analyst to confidently presenting with her CFO
  • Career transitions: Amy's shift from psychology to accounting, and George's move from corporate work to criminal defense law
  • Perspectives on AI in their respective fields, with both seeing AI as a helpful efficiency tool requiring human oversight
  • Effective public speaking techniques, emphasizing storytelling, humor, and audience engagement
  • Future plans including Amy completing her Level 4 public relations speech project and Apex developing a podcast for the club

Apex Toastmasters is a President's distinguished club founded in 1996 and located in Apex, North Carolina, USA.

We meet every Thursday night at 7:00 pm at the Apex Baptist Church and online. See club website for details.
